Have an older, higher-mileage Hemi. Runs great with various 0w-40's in the sump (Mobil 1, Non-SRT Pennzoil), but the TICK-TICK-TICK was very apparent - enough so that someone unaware of Hemi idiosyncrasies would think the engine had a mechanical issue.
Made the switch to Red Line 5w-30 and that same tick is now imperceptible. Seriously, folks. Is this stuff
relatively expensive? Sure, but it's coming out of the same bank account as everything else you purchase in life, and in that grand scheme of things, it's small potatoes for how dramatic the difference was.
